Master of Engineering Science in Electrical and Computer Engineering from Western University Overview
Master of Engineering Science in Electrical and Computer Engineering from Western University is a 2 year program offered at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ering. Western University accepts most English proficiency tests for international student admissions, including TOEFL,and IELTS. Indian Students with good academic scores are eligible for Merit Based scholarship. Western University had 94.3% graduation rate, graduates employed within 6 months to 2 years post-graduation. The acceptance rate at Western University in Ontario, Canada, is approximately 58%, indicating a moderately selective admissions process.

Eligibility & Entry Requirement
Category | Details |
---|---|
School |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ering |
Program Duration | 2 Year |
Academic Requirements | Applicant must have a four-year undergraduate degree in Engineering or a related field with minimum score of 70% from a recognized university. |
GPA Requirements | Minimum 70% average in the last two years of undergraduate study. |

Application Fee | CAD $150 |
Documents Required | - Completed online application - Official transcripts - Statement of research interests - Two academic references - Proof of English language proficiency |
